Lakewood Elementary School students recently celebrated Dr. Seuss’ birthday on Read Across America Day with student athletes from Wootton High School and the University of Maryland. This annual event is all about promoting literacy. MCPS-TV has the story, below:

Damascus Running Back Jake Funk Commits to Maryland (VIDEO)
Damascus star running back Jake Funk has committed to play next year at the University of Maryland.
